MUSIC PRAXIS 5113

Which of the following is generally not true of a march? – answer It should feature
slowed-down tempos when playing piano dynamics.

Which of the following music terms is best defined as an ornament, or embellishment, in
which the performed note is first brushed-as in a flam-by the note just above it, before
playing that note for almost its entire value? – answer Acciaccatura

What is the term for polyphony based on the same thematic material? – answer
Imitative polyphony

What is the name for the following music symbol? "//" (2 slashes) – answer Caesura

Which of the following rationales best justifies a teacher who advocates for beginning
trumpet players to use both letter names and tonal syllables when learning songs by
rote, by ear, as well as by notation? – answer It makes transposition easier than using
note names and steps.

What does internal expansion refer to? – answer Notes that are added to the middle of
a melody

What is the key signature for a piece in D-flat major? - answer5 flats

What type of chord is built on the second degree of a major scale? - answerA minor
chord (ii in a major scale)

How many beats are in a measure of 6/8 time, and what is the value of each beat? -
answerThere are 6 beats, with each beat being an eighth note

Which composer is known for the "Brandenburg Concertos"? - answerJohann
Sebastian Bach

During which historical period did Beethoven primarily compose? - answerThe Classical
and early Romantic periods.

How did the development of opera in the Baroque period reflect the cultural and social
values of the time? - answerThe Baroque period's opera emphasized dramatic
expression and elaborate musical forms, reflecting the era's interest in drama and
grandeur.

What is one effective method for teaching rhythm to beginner students? - answerUsing
clapping or tapping exercises to practice rhythmic patterns and time signatures.
